The Perception Bottleneck: Why Traditional Cameras Fail in Disaster Zones

Ukususwa kwezinsalela ezivela ezinhlekeleleni kungenye yemisebenzi enzima kakhulu ezinhlelweni zamarobhothi, ikakhulukazi ngenxa yesimo sezindawo ezinhlekeleleni esingalindeleki futhi esiyingozi. Izakhiwo ezibhidlikile, insimbi egobile, ukhonkolo oluhlakazekile, nezindlela ezifihlekileyo zakha inkundla yezinzwa lapho amakhamera ajwayelekile nezinhlelo zokubona eziyisisekelo ezingakwazi ukuzulazula kahle. Ngokungafani nezindawo zezimboni ezihlelekile, izindawo ezinhlekeleleni azinawo ukukhanya okungaguquki, izindawo ezicacile, kanye nezingaphezulu ezifanayo—konke lokhu kuyadingeka ukuze izinhlelo zokubona zamarobhothi ezijwayelekile zisebenze ngokuthembekile.
Ngokombiko ka-2025 ovela kuHhovisi leNhlangano Yezizwe Ezibambisene Lokunciphisa Ingozi Yezinhlekelele (UNDRR), ngaphezu kuka-40% wezinhlelo zokuhlanza imfucumfucu ngezithuthuthu ziyahluleka ngenxa yokungabi khona kokubona kahle imvelo, okuholela ekubambezelekeni kwemisebenzi yokusiza nokwandisa ingozi kubasindisi abantu. Amakhamera ajwayelekile ayahluleka ezimweni zokukhanya okuphansi, intuthu, uthuli, nokungena kwamanzi—izithiyo ezijwayelekile ezindaweni zenhlekelele. Aphinde angabi namandla okwehlukanisa phakathi kwezinto ezibalulekile (njengabasindile, izinto eziyingozi, noma izakhiwo ezingazinzile) kanye nemfucumfucu engabalulekile, okwenza imisebenzi yezithuthuthu ingasebenzi futhi ingase ibe yingozi.
Le nkinga yokubona yileyo lapho amakhamera e-AI angena khona. Ngokuhlanganisa izindlela ezithuthukisiwe zokubona ngekhompyutha, amamodeli okufunda ngomshini, kanye nezingxenye ezakhiwe ngokuqinile, amakhamera e-AI enza imishini yokuzenzakalela ikwazi ukuthi "iqonde" imvelo yayo kunokuba "iyibone" nje. Leli khono eliguqulayo lenza imishini yokuzenzakalela isuke kumathuluzi angasebenzi ibe izakhamuzi ezisebenzayo, ezihlakaniphile ekuphenduleni inhlekelele.

Ubuchwepheshe Obuyisisekelo: Okwenza Amakhamera E-AI Afanelekele Ukususwa Kwezinqwaba Ngemishini Yokuzenzakalela

Amakhamera e-AI okususwa kwezinqwaba ngenxa yenhlekelele ngemishini yokuzenzakalela awawona nje amakhamera abantu abawasebenzisayo athuthukisiwe—awuhlelo olukhethekile olwenzelwe ukuthi luphumelele ezimweni ezinzima ngenkathi lunikeza imininingwane engasetshenziswa. Ubuchwepheshe obuyisisekelo obulandelayo obenza bingenakwehluleka kulolu hlelo lokusebenza olubalulekile:

1. Ukuhlanganiswa Kokuzwa Okuningi Nokufunda Okujulile

Amakhamera e-AI Amandla ahlanganisa ukuthwebula kwe-RGB nokubona ubujamo, ukuzwa okushisayo, namayunithi okulinganisa okungaguquki (ama-IMU) ukuze kwakhiwe umbono ophelele wendawo yesigameko esibi. Lolu lwazi oluningi luyacutshungulwa ngesikhathi sangempela kusetshenziswa amamodeli okufunda ajulile, njenge-You Only Look Once (YOLO) ne-ResNet50, aqeqeshwe ukubona izinhlobo zezinto ezichithekile, izingozi zezakhiwo, ngisho nezimpawu zokuphila komuntu. Ngokwesibonelo, amamodeli e-YOLO abonakale ephumelela kakhulu ekuhlonzeni ngokushesha izinhlobo ezahlukene zezinto ezichithekile—kusuka emabhulokini kakhonkolo kuya emishayo yensimbi—ngesilinganiso sokunemba esingaphezu kuka-94%, njengoba kuboniswe ocwaningweni luka-2025 lokuhlola izinto ezichithekile emifuleni.
I-Thermal imaging, isici esibalulekile samakhamera amaningi e-AI asetshenziswa ekuphenduleni inhlekelele, ivumela amarobhothi ukuthi athole abasindile abantu ngokusebenzisa imfucumfucu nasezindaweni ezinokubonakala okuphansi. Ngemuva kohlulelo olukhulu lwaseTurkey-Syria lwango-2023, izimoto ezingenawo umshayeli ezihambayo (UGVs) ezihlome ngamakhamera e-AI anikwe amandla yi-AI zikwazile ukuthola abasindile abayi-12 ezakhiweni eziwile, kunciphisa ingozi kubaphenduli babantu ababeyodinga ukungena ezakhiweni ezingazinzile.

2. UkuProcessing kwe-Edge AI ukuze Kwenziwe Izinqumo Ngalesi sikhathi

Omunye wezithuthukisi ezibaluleke kakhulu kubuchwepheshe be-AI kamera ukuProcessing kwe-edge AI. Ngokwehlukile kumasistimu e-AI asefu, adinga uxhumano lwe-inthanethi oluqinile futhi abhekana nezikhathi zokulibaziseka, i-edge AI iprocessa idatha ngqo kukhamera noma emrobotini uqobo. Lokhu kubalulekile ezindaweni ezinhlekeleleni, lapho ukwakhiwa kokuxhumana kuvame ukulimala noma kungatholakali.
Amakhamera anikwe amandla yi-Edge AI avumela amarobhothi ukuthi enze izinqumo ezisheshayo—njengokugwema imfucumfucu engazinzile, ukudlula izithiyo, noma ukuma ukuze kuhlolwe umuntu osaphila—ngaphandle kokuxhomeka kumaseva akude. I-The Ocean Cleanup, inhlangano engenzi inzuzo egxile ekususeni imfucumfucu yasolwandle, isebenzise i-edge AI ukuthuthukisa ukutholwa kwezinto ezilahlwayo ezindaweni ezikude zasolwandle, lapho ukuxhumana kukhawulelwe futhi amandla ayindlala. Lobu buchwepheshe obufanayo manje buyasetshenziswa ekususeni imfucumfucu ezinhlekeleleni ezisezweni, buvumela amarobhothi ukuthi asebenze ngokuzimela isikhathi eside.

3. Izingxenye Zikagesi Eziqinile Ezimweni Ezimbi Kakhulu

Amakhamera e-AI okususa imfucumfucu ezinhlekeleleni ezisebenzisa amarobhothi kumele akhiwe ukuze akwazi ukumelana nezimo ezinzima kakhulu, okubandakanya uthuli, amanzi, izinga lokushisa elidlulele, nokushaywa yizinto. Amakhamera e-AI asezingeni lezimboni njenge-Stereolabs ZED X Mini enziwe ngezinga lokuvikela le-IP67, okwenza ukuthi angangeni uthuli futhi angamelana namanzi afinyelela kumamitha angu-1 ukujula. Aphinde abe nemiklamo emincane, eqinile engahlanganiswa kalula kuma-UGV namadroni amancane, alungele ukuzulazula ezindaweni eziyimfihlo ezakhiweni eziwile.
La makhamera aphinde anikele ngokubona okujulile okunembayo, anebanga elifika kumamitha angu-12 namazinga afika ku-60fps, aqinisekisa ukuthi oo-robhothi bangakwazi ukuhamba ngokushesha nangokuphepha ezindaweni ezinemfucumfucu. Ukwengezwa kwamakhono okuvumelanisa ihadiwe kuvumela amakhamera amaningi ukuthi asebenze ndawonye, ​​adale umbono ongama-degree angu-360 wendawo ezungezile futhi aqede izindawo ezingabonakali—isici esibalulekile sokugwema ukungqubuzana nokuthola izingozi ezifihliwe.

4. Ukwakhiwa Kabusha Okusheshayo Kwesigameko Esingu-3D

Another game-changing technology is the ability of AI cameras to generate high-precision 3D maps of disaster zones in real time. Traditional simultaneous localization and mapping (SLAM) systems are slow and require precise camera calibration, making them impractical for time-sensitive disaster response. However, recent advancements from institutions like MIT have led to AI-powered SLAM systems that can generate 3D maps in seconds without the need for manual calibration.
Uhlelo lwe-MIT oluphumelelayo lusebenza ngokuhlukanisa imvelo ibe "submaps" ezincane, lusebenza ngalinye le-submap ngokwehlukana, bese lihlukanisa ndawonye sisebenzisa ama-algorithms akhuphukayo. Le ndlela yehlisa umthwalo wokubala ngenkathi igcina ukunembeka, ngokuphambuka okujwayelekile kokwakha okungaphansi kuka-5 centimeters. Ekususeni udoti nge-robot, lokhu kusho ukuthi ama-robot angakwazi ngokushesha ukuhlela imvelo engaziwa, athole izindlela eziphephile, futhi ahlele izindlela zokuhlanza udoti - konke ngesikhathi sangempela.

Impumelelo Yangempela: Amakhamera e-AI Esikhathini Esisebenzayo

Izinzuzo zemibono zamakhamera e-AI ziyaqinisekiswa ezigamekweni zangempela zokuphendula inhlekelele, ngemiphumela ecacile ngokuya ngempumelelo, ukuphepha, nokusindisa izimpilo. Nansi eminye imizekelo evelele yokusetshenziswa kwawo:

Impendulo yeZikhukhula eTurkey (2023-2025)

Ngemuva kokuzamazama komhlaba okubhubhisayo eTurkey-Syria ngo-2023, abacwaningi abavela eNyuvesi yase-Ankara bathuthukisa i-UGV ehlanganisiwe efakwe amakhamera e-AI, izinzwa ezishisayo, namayunithi okucubungula i-NVIDIA Jetson Nano. Lezi ziroboti zathunyelwa ukuthi zihlolisise izakhiwo eziwile ukuze kutholwe abasindile, zisebenzisa i-AI ukuhlaziya idatha eshisayo nebonakalayo ngesikhathi sangempela. Uhlelo lwaqaphela ngempumelelo abasindile abangu-27 enyangeni yokuqala yokuthunyelwa, futhi ukusetshenziswa kwalo kunciphise inani labaphenduli abantu ababedingeka ezindaweni ezinobungozi obukhulu ngo-60%. Lo msebenzi, oxhaswe yi-NVIDIA’s Disaster Response Innovation Grant, ubuye wabonisa ukuthi amakhamera e-AI angahlanganiswa kanjani ezinhlelweni zama-robotic ezishibhile, ezikaliwe—ezibalulekile ekwamukelweni okubanzi emazweni asathuthuka.

Ukuhlola Okuzimele Kwezinsalela Zokwakha

Nakuba kungewona isimo esingokwezinhlekelele ngqo, ukuqapha okuzenzakalelayo imfucumfucu yokwakha kusetshenziswa amakhamera e-AI kanye nama-drone kunikeza imininingwane ebalulekile ngobukhulu balobu buchwepheshe. Iphrojekthi ka-2025 eyenziwa yi-AI Superior yathuthukisa uhlelo lwekhamera ye-AI olusekelwe ku-drone olwalukwazi ukuthola izinhlobo ezingama-25 ezihlukene zemfucumfucu yokwakha, okuhlanganisa izitini, izinduku zensimbi, namaloli esihlabathi. Uhlelo lwamukelwa omkhandlu kamasipala abaningana, lwehlisa isikhathi sokuhlola ngo-70% futhi lwehlisa izindleko ngo-40% uma kuqhathaniswa nokuhlola ngesandla. Lobu buchwepheshe obufanayo manje buyasetshenziswa kabusha ukuze kuhlaziywe imfucumfucu ngemuva kwezinhlekelele, buvumela amaqembu okuphendula ukuthi akwazi ukubona ngokushesha izindawo ezinemifucumfucu futhi aphambanise imizamo yokuhlanza.

Ukususa Imfucumfucu Yesikhukhula Ezindaweni Zedolobha

Izikhukhula zivame ukushiya ngemuva imfucumfucu eningi entantayo engavimba izimiso zokudonsa amanzi futhi yonakalise ingqalasizinda. Ngo-2024, abacwaningi eChina basebenzise amarobhothi ahlakaniphile ahlome nge-AI ukususa imfucumfucu ezikhukhuleni ezindaweni zasemadolobheni. La marobhothi asebenzise amakhamera e-AI anezindlu ezivimbela amanzi ukuzulazula emigwaqweni ekhukhulwe amanzi, ukukhomba imfucumfucu, futhi ukuqoqa ngengalo yomshini. Uhlelo lwakwazi ukususa imfucumfucu ngezinga lama-cubic meters angama-200 ngehora—kaphinda kathathu ngokushesha kuneqembu labantu—ngesikhathi kuncishiswa ingozi yokuchayeka ezifweni ezithwalwa ngamanzi kubasebenzi babantu.

Izinselele Nekusasa Lamakhamera E-AI Ekuphenduleni Izinhlekelele

Ngaphandle kokuqhubeka okubalulekile, amakhamera e-AI okususa imfucumfucu ye-robotic asabhekana nezinselele eziningana okufanele zixazululwe ukuze kukhululwe amandla awo aphelele. Enye yezithiyo ezinkulu ukuntuleka kwedatha: ukuqeqesha amamodeli e-AI kudinga amasethi amakhulu, ahlukahlukene emvelo yezinhlekelele, okunzima ukuqoqa ngenxa yesimo sezinhlekelele esingalindelekile. Abacwaningi bayalungisa lokhu ngokudala amasethi edatha okwenziwa kanye nokusebenzisa ukufunda kokudlulisa ukuze kuvunyelaniswe amamodeli aqeqeshwe ezindaweni zezimboni ezimweni zezinhlekelele.
Enye inselelo ukuhlanganiswa kwamakhamera e-AI nezinye zobuchwepheshe bokuphendula ezinhlekeleleni, njengezindiza, ama-UGVs, nezikhungo zok command. Nakuba izinhlelo ezihlukene ziya ziba sezingeni eliphezulu, ukudala inethiwekhi engaguquguquki, esebenzisanayo yezinsiza kuqhubeka kuyinto ebalulekile. Izindinganiso zokwabelana ngedatha nokuxhumana zidingeka ukuze kuqinisekiswe ukuthi idatha yekhamera ye-AI ingahlanganiswa nezinye izinzwa futhi isetshenziswe ukuze kuqondiswe izinqumo ngesikhathi sangempela ngamaqembu aphendulayo.
Ngokubheka esikhathini esizayo, kunezinto eziningana ezijabulisayo ezizayo. Ukuqhubeka kwezinto ezincane kakhulu kuyovumela amakhamera e-AI ukuthi afakwe kumalobothi amancane, ahamba kalula—njengamalobothi afana nenyoka angakwazi ukuhamba ezindaweni eziwumgodi ezakhiweni eziwile. Ukuqhubeka kobuchwepheshe bebhethri kuyokwandisa isikhathi sokusebenza samalobothi anikwe amandla yi-AI, abavumele ukuthi asebenze izinsuku ngaphandle kokushajwa. Ngaphezu kwalokho, ukuthuthukiswa kwezinhlelo zamalobothi amaningi, lapho amalobothi amaningi anamakhamera e-AI asebenzisana ukususa imfucumfucu nokufuna abasindile, kuyokwandisa ukusebenza kahle nokumbozwa.
Mhlawumbe okubaluleke kakhulu, izindleko zobuchwepheshe be-AI kamera ziya phansi, okwenza kube lula ukufinyelela ezindaweni ezibhekene nezinhlekelele nasemazweni athuthukayo. Njengoba lezi zinhlelo ziba nezindleko eziphansi, azizokwazi kuphela ukuba semathubeni ezinhlekeleleni ezinkulu kodwa zizotholakala kumaqembu ezimo eziphuthumayo endaweni, okuvumela ukuphendula okusheshayo nokusebenza kahle ezinhlekeleleni ezincane.
